> RelToSqlConverter should use ordinal for ORDER BY if the dialect allows

> For example:
> Query SQL isĀ
> {code:java}
> select a, sum(b) from table group by a order by 2{code}
> When we convert this sql to relNode and convert it back to SQL by
> RelToConverter, the result is:
> {code:java}
> select a, sum(b) from table group by a order by sum(b){code}
> But we want to keep order by column to ordinal.
> Would we add a switch in RelToConverter to control whether convert sort by
> column to expression or ordinal?
> Maybe we can use method isSortByOrdinal in dialect SqlConformance?
